Pocket's popular AI notetaker launched 8 months ago. Revenue is soaring, but can it last?

Akshay Narisetti (left) and Gabriel Dymowski, the cofounders of Pocket. Pocket Pocket is an AI notetaker hardware startup that went through Y Combinator this year. It told Business Insider it reached a $100 million run rate eight months after launching its product. The tech graveyard is already littered with failed AI devices, but Pocket hopes it can endure.
